Overview
AutoCAD Plant 3D Spec Editor Training is a practical, hands-on program designed to equip learners with specialized skills in creating, editing, and managing piping specifications and catalogs using the Plant 3D Spec Editor tool. This training focuses on building custom piping specs, managing component libraries, standardizing engineering data, integrating catalogs, and ensuring consistency across plant design projects. Participants will gain real-world experience in developing industry-standard piping specifications for industrial plant design workflows.

Course Outline
Introduction to Plant 3D Spec Editor and Workflow Basics
โข Overview of Spec Editor tool and purpose
โข Relationship between specs and catalogs
โข Understanding piping standards and components
โข Project integration concepts
Catalog Structure and Component Management
โข Exploring Plant 3D catalogs
โข Component hierarchy and definitions
โข Editing and organizing catalog data
โข Adding custom components
Creating Piping Specifications
โข Building new piping specs from scratch
โข Defining pipe types, sizes, and ratings
โข Assigning valves, fittings, and accessories
โข Spec validation fundamentals
